1 River Cats Media Relations 400 Ballpark Drive West Sacramento, CA P: (916) F: (916) Wednesday, June 3, 2015 Chicksaw Bricktown Ballpark Oklahoma City, OK 5:05 p.m. (PDT) Game 54 Road Game 26 SACRAMENTO RIVER CATS (24-29, 3rd Pacific Northern) - vs - OKLAHOMA CITY DODGERS (36-15, 1st American Northern) River Cats: LHP Ty Blach (4-5, 3.82) Dodgers: RHP Zach Lee (5-3, 2.38) Last Night s Game: The River Cats took the first game of their series with the Oklahoma City Dodgers last night by a score of the River Cats jumped ahead early, scoring three times in the first inning on an RBI-single from INF Travis Ishikawa and a two-run single by OF Juan Perez...those three runs were all the River Cats needed, as the pitching staff was dominant... LHP Nik Turley made his second Triple-A start and shut down the Dodgers, allowing just 1 run (earned) on 5 hits and 2 walks while striking out 4...he recorded 6 of his outs on the ground and 7 in the air while throwing 59 of 95 pitches for strikes...rhp Cody Hall and RHP Erik Cordier each picked up a hold, throwing a combined 3 innings, allowing 1 unearned run on 3 hits and 2 walks...they struck out 2...RHP Michael Broadway recorded his fifth save in as many chances last night, throwing a perfect ninth inning to close out the game...inf Casey McGehee was 2-for-4 with a run, Ishikiawa was 1-for-3 with a walk, a run, and an RBI, and newcomer INF Kevin Frandsen was 2-for-4 in his River Cats debut. Tonight s Starting Pitcher: LHP Ty Blach will head to the bump today for Sacramento as they look to win their second in a row...blach is 4-5 on the season and has lost his last two in a row...despite walking 4 in his last 12 innings, Blach s 1.03 BB/9 is still the second best in the PCL...threw over 100 pitches in each of his last two outings...he threw 67 of 107 (63%) for strikes on 5/25 vs. MEM and 65 of 103 (also 63%) for strikes on 5/29 at COL...on the season, Blach has thrown 604 of his 914 pitches for strikes (66%). 500 Seems So Close: OF Jarrett Parker remains one hit shy of 500 for his career...parker picked up hit #499 on 5/31 at COL, but has been hitless in his last two games...is 0-for-6 with 2 walks and 4 strikeouts since reaching 499. Leading Late: Last night s win was the River Cats 20th victory when leading after 8 innings... for the season, Sacramento is 20-0 when leading after 8 innings (11-0 on the road)...when leading after 7 innings, they are 20-2 (also 11-0 on the road). Right Down Broadway: RHP Michael Broadway recorded his fifth save of the season in last night s win...broadway is a perfect 5/5 in save opportunities this season...his K/9 (37 Ks in 24.1 IP) is the best in the PCL and his 7.40 base runners per nine innings is also the best in the PCL...has posted a.167 batting average against, the fourth lowest among qualifiers in the league. 11 ADVANCED STATISTICS - HITTING HITTERS PA OPS ISO BABIP wrc woba BB% K% Adam Duvall % 22.4% Juan Perez % 21.7% Jarrett Parker % 34.4% Ronny Cedeno % 13.7% Darren Ford % 18.3% Ehire Adrianza % 20.2% Carlos Triunfel % 20.3% Trevor Brown % 15.3% Travis Ishikawa % 27.9% Skyler Stromsmoe % 10.0% Casey Mcgehee % 11.1% Hector Sanchez % 17.9% Kevin Frandsen % 0.0% ADVANCED STATISTICS - PITCHING PITCHERS TBF AVG BABIP LOB% FIP BB% K% Ty Blach % % 12.6% Jake Dunning % % 17.3% Cody Hall % % 18.3% Curtis Partch % % 30.4% Clayton Blackburn % % 16.2% Steven Okert % % 28.3% Mike Broadway % % 40.2% Brett Bochy % % 14.6% Clay Rapada % % 11.7% Nik Turley % % 10.6% Erik Cordier % % 35.0% Cory Gearrin % % 14.3% Jake Peavy - # % % 8.3% - active players (excluding pitchers) # - Major League Rehab - active players # - Major League Rehab ADVANCED STATISTICS GLOSSARY* PA: Plate Appearances Plate Appearances are the total number of times a hitter completes a turn batting. BABIP: Batting Average on Balls In Play Batting Average on Balls In Play (BABIP) measures how many of a batter s balls in play go for hits. Affected greatly by defense and luck, BABIP can dramatically affect a hitter s batting average. If a large number of a batter s balls in play go for hits, that can boost their batting average quite high. Similarly, if a large number of balls in play get caught, it can reduce a player s total offensive value. ISO: Isolated Power Isolated Power (ISO) is a measure of a hitter s raw power. Or, to look at it another way, it measures how good a player is at hitting for extra bases. The simplest way to calculate ISO is to subtract a player s Batting Average from their Slugging Percentage, which leaves us with a measure of just a player s extra bases per at bat. woba: Weighted On-Base Average Weighted On-Base Average combines all the different aspects of hitting into one metric, weighting each of them in proportion to their actual run value. While batting average, on-base percentage, and slugging percentage fall short in accuracy and scope, woba measures and captures offensive value more accurately and comprehensively. (Due to no constant in minor league baseball, the woba statistic is approximate). K% & BB%: Strikeout Rate and Walk Rate Strikeout rate (K%) and walk rate (BB%) measure how often a position player walks or strikes out per plate appearance, or how often a pitcher walks or strikes out a player per plate appearance. They re measured in percentage form, so it s easy to compare between players and years. wrc: Weighted Runs Created Runs created measures the total number of runs a player contributes to their team. The formula accounts for a player s ability to get on base, their total number of bases, and their baserunning. TBF: Total Batters Faced Total Batters Faced measures the total number of plate appearances hitters have made against him. FIP: Fielding Independent Pitching Fielding Independent Pitching (FIP) measures what a player s ERA should have looked like over a given time period, assuming that performance on balls in play and timing were league average. (Due to no constant in minor league baseball, the FIP statistic is approximate). LOB%: Left On Base Percentage Left on Base Percentage (LOB%) measures the percentage of base runners that a pitcher strands on base over the course of a season. This stat does not use the left on base numbers reported in box scores, but instead is calculated using a pitcher s actual hits, walks, and runs allowed results. *Courtesy of Fangraphs.com
